From: Comparison and evaluation of two different methods to establish the cigarette smoke exposure mouse model of COPD

Figure 8

Representative light micrographs of distal small vessels of mouse’s lung (A) and the α-SMA staining (B), the vessel wall area (C), and the vessel wall thickness (D), following the group of nose-only CS exposure (CS-NO) or air control (CTL-NO) and the group of whole-body CS exposure (CS-WB) or air control (CTL-WB). Scale bar = 50 μm. Data are presented as mean ± SD (n = 5), *P < 0.01 for CS-NO group vs. CTL-NO group, # P < 0.01 for CS-WB group vs. CTL-WB group, & P < 0.05 for CS-NO group vs. CS-WB group.
